エ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
coffeescriptでファットアローとthisの両方使いたいとき - リア充爆発日記
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
coffeescriptでファットアローとthisの両方使いたいとき - リア充爆発日記
こんな感じのときの話。 <li class="someArea"><button><i class="icon-trash"></i></button></li> $som... こんな感じのときの話。 <li class="someArea"><button><i class="icon-trash"></i></button></li> $someArea.on("click", (evt) => @obj.trigger("triggerOnClick", $(this))) ここで俺っちが$(this)に入っててほしいのはliなんだけど、この場合は当然this=@ですから目的は果たせない。 ファットアローじゃないと@objにアクセスできないし、thisも使いたいしどうしよう困ったでも使えないからevtから辿るしかないよねと思ってtargetにしてみた。 $someArea.on("click", (evt) => @obj.trigger("triggerOnClick", $(evt.target))) そうすると、今度はクリックのしどころによって入ってく